MindsEye Developer Says Its Working on Patch as Players Report Performance Issues, Bugs at Launch
- Wednesday June 11, 2025
- Written by Manas Mitul
MindsEye developer Build A Rocket Boy has said it is working on a patch to improve performance on PC and consoles after players reported severe technical issues at launch. The game received its day one patch on June 10 across PC, PS5 and Xbox Series S/X.
